    Soundbars able to reproducing the atmospheric results of Dolby Atmos soundtracks have been round since 2016, however till now they have not been very modern. To work nicely, Atmos units want further audio system to breed these top results, and often they’re small, static drivers aimed on the ceiling. The Vizio Elevate prices a bundle nevertheless it tries one thing radically new: motorized audio system that stand up and revolve in accordance with whether or not you are listening to music or a suitable film. The craziest half is, it truly works!

    The Vizio Elevate is a 5.1.4 soundbar which affords compatibility with each immersive requirements: Dolby Atmos and DTS:X. In addition to the primary speaker itself, the Elevate’s setup consists of rears, a big subwoofer and a distant. If you needed to deck out the Arc with an analogous array of audio system, particularly the Sonos Sub and two Symfonisk for the rear channels, it will value about $1,700.The Vizio Elevate could also be a plastic soundbar at coronary heart however its design is… ahem… elevated. The predominant bar feels sturdy and is available in a two-tone end — half thick vinyl wrap and half gun-metal aluminum. This is a giant speaker at 48 inches large and a table-swallowing 6.5 inches deep. The ends are coated in a matte-black materials, which makes it onerous to see the matte-black controls, however the raised buttons are literally simpler to make use of by contact. The entrance of the soundbar features a coloured LED that makes it comparatively easy to inform which enter you might be on, in addition to a white LED stage meter.

    The predominant speaker incorporates a whopping 13 drivers, together with a devoted middle channel and 5 tweeters in complete. The swiveling audio system are located at every finish and rotate when the system detects a Dolby Atmos/DTS:X sign, revealing the Atmos brand on one aspect and DTS:X on the opposite. 
    Ty Pendlebury/CNET
    The subwoofer is among the largest I’ve seen on any system, measuring 11 inches large by 14 inches deep and 16 inches excessive. The rear audio system function each forward-facing and upward-firing drivers and are tethered to the sub by a 30-foot cable (the connection between the soundbar and the sub is wi-fi). The cable was lengthy sufficient to drape behind my sofa and alongside the aspect of the residing house to the sub on the entrance, however the size could possibly be a problem for some installations. Vizio claims the system is able to 107 decibels, and I did discover it was fairly loud, so no worries about filling even the most important residing areas. The Elevate features a wall-mount bracket within the field (BYO screws, nonetheless), and Vizio designed the bar to mate seamlessly with the Vizio OLED TV.A mountain of optionsConnectivity is great with two separate HDMI inputs, one among which helps eARC, in addition to optical digital, a 3.5mm analog audio and a 3.5mm “voice assistant” enter, USB and Bluetooth. The Elevate connects to your community through Wi-Fi and helps Spotify Connect and Chromecast built-in. Unlike the Arc, it lacks Apple AirPlay help however its bodily connectivity is much better than the Arc’s.
